Title: Understanding Hillsboro Oregon Restrictive Covenant Agreeing to Future Dedication for Road and Utility Purposes Introduction: In Hillsboro, Oregon, restrictive covenants agreeing to future dedication for road and utility purposes play a crucial role in the development and maintenance of infrastructure. These covenants ensure that adequate provisions are made for roads, utilities, and other essential services as the city evolves. This article dives into the details of Hillsboro Oregon restrictive covenants, outlining their purpose, types, and importance. 1. What is a Restrictive Covenant? A restrictive covenant is a legal agreement between a property owner and the governing authority (usually a city or municipality), specifying certain limitations or obligations concerning the use or development of the property. 2. Purpose of Hillsboro Oregon Restrictive Covenant: The primary objective of Hillsboro Oregon restrictive covenants agreeing to future dedication for road and utility purposes is to ensure the orderly and sustainable growth of the city's infrastructure. By setting aside adequate space for roads, sidewalks, utilities, and more, these covenants facilitate effective urban planning, reduce congestion, and provide necessary services to residents. 3. Types of Hillsboro Oregon Restrictive Covenant: i. Roadway Dedication Covenant: This type of covenant requires the property owner to dedicate a strip of land for future road construction or expansion, as determined by the city's transportation planning. ii. Utility Dedication Covenant: Under this covenant, property owners agree to set aside portions of their property for utility infrastructure, including but not limited to water, sewer, gas, electric, and telecommunication lines. iii. Easement Covenant: This covenant grants the city or authorized entities the right to access specific portions of the property to maintain and service the infrastructure dedicated by the property owner in the form of a road or utility covenant. 4. Process and Implementation: To establish a restrictive covenant, property owners must work closely with the governing authority, usually the City of Hillsboro, Oregon. This typically involves the following steps: a. Planning and Zoning Review: Property owners may need to consult with the city's planning and zoning department to determine the specific requirements for their development project as it relates to dedications for roads and utilities. b. Legal Documentation: Restrictive covenants must be prepared and documented accurately to ensure their legal enforceability. c. Approval and Decoration: The restrictive covenant agreement is reviewed and approved by the city authorities, after which it is recorded in the appropriate public records. 5. Importance and Benefits: Hillsboro Oregon restrictive covenants agreeing to future dedication for road and utility purposes offer several key benefits, including: a. Planned Infrastructure: These covenants ensure that new developments plan for roadways and utilities, preventing potential issues from unplanned growth. b. Increased Efficiency: Properly allocated road and utility spaces improve traffic flow, reducing congestion and promoting overall efficiency in the community. c. Sustainable Development: By setting aside land for infrastructure needs, restrictive covenants contribute to sustainable urban planning and the city's long-term development goals. A restrictive covenant may include things that you can't do with your property, like raise livestock. A restrictive covenant will also include things that you must do, like mow your lawn regularly.

To find out what, if any, deed restrictions are attached to a particular piece of acreage, visit the county courthouse in the county where the land is located to check the county deed records.
